New Stuff from Alltimers

Alltimers are a firm CSC favourite. We love them, and you should too. All new tees, and decks from Alltimers ready for you buy online at CSC now.

Alltimers always come through strong in the graphics department. This is season's product is no different. Strong artwork and high grade clothing. It's everything you could ever want really. In this drop we've got the all new Digi tees, the cartoon animals inspired Bears and Rich Zoo tees, new colourways in the League Player tees, a Sears crew, alongside the Black Caviar deck and our own personal favourite the Steven Seagal Killing It deck.
